WebThe same formula holds when the spring is in a compressed state, with F and x both are negative in that state. According to the force/spring constant formula, the graph of the applied force F as a function of the displacement x will be a straight line that passes through the origin, whose slope is k. WebThe force exerted back by the spring is known as Hooke's law. \vec F_s= -k \vec x F s = −kx. Where F_s F s is the force exerted by the spring, x x is the displacement relative to the unstretched length of the spring, and k k is the spring constant. Web8 Apr 2024 · Force of the Spring = - (Spring Constant) x (Displacement) F=−K*X F=−KX The negative sign indicates the opposite direction of the reaction force. Where, F: The spring's restoring force directed towards equilibrium. K: The constant of spring in N.m-1. X: The displacement of the spring from its position of equilibrium.
